Transaction 3e53580743a93b2b363f2cf37beaeae3b63a58f945dcab65ab59dc7618ad76f7
1 Input
2 Outputs
- 3e53580743a93b2b363f2cf37beaeae3b63a58f945dcab65ab59dc7618ad76f7:0
- 3e53580743a93b2b363f2cf37beaeae3b63a58f945dcab65ab59dc7618ad76f7:1
value 1197988
address 3FufbWxQRYYdZxNySDxoDmhBapXbedTLko
value 68211083
address 1D35hdUUnCGXy3BAbvAjc1Ng4vJBvEojUo